How to use Protect PDF Files (and Merge PDF Pages Too) in Seconds

  1. Drop your PDF in. Drag the file straight from your downloads folder into the dropzone, or click to browse. Works with single files or merged study packs.
  2. Set a password. Pick a strong password you'll actually remember. This is what readers will need to open the document.
  3. Choose permissions. Toggle whether others can print, copy text, or edit the file. Lock it all down for sensitive work, or leave printing on for handouts.
  4. Apply protection. Hit the protect button and the tool encrypts your PDF locally in your browser — no uploads, no waiting in a queue.
  5. Download and share. Save the protected copy and send it off. The original stays untouched on your device in case you need to tweak settings later.

Frequently asked

Is this actually free for students? Yep, totally free. No sign-up, no credit card, no watermarks slapped on your thesis. Use it as often as you need during the semester.
Will my files get uploaded somewhere? No. Protection happens right in your browser, so your essays, IDs, and personal docs never leave your device.
Can I protect a merged PDF? Definitely. Combine your lecture notes or chapters first, then drop the merged file here to add a password and lock permissions.
What if I forget the password? There's no recovery — that's the point of encryption. Save it in a password manager or somewhere safe before you share the file.
Can I stop people from copying text out of my paper? Yes. Switch off the copy permission and readers won't be able to highlight and paste sections into their own assignments.
Does it work on my Chromebook or phone? It runs in any modern browser, so Chromebooks, tablets, and phones all work. Handy for last-minute fixes between classes.
Will the protection break if I edit the PDF later? If you re-export the file from another editor, you'll need to re-apply protection here. The settings only stick to the version you download.
